    Air Suspension fault - C1A18-64

    Hi All,

    I had the fault C1A18-64 Pressure increases too rapid when filling reservoir - Algorithm based failure - Signal plausibility faill

    The orange triangle illuminates intermittently about 30 seconds after staring the car and resets after switching off and restarting. Has anyone seen this before and any suggestions what it may be?

    My assumption is that either the pressure sensor is faulty due to over-reading or the valve to the reservoir isn't opening properly.

    well, i believe i have rectified my issue. I purchased a new Rear Valve Block RHV000055 from Ebay. Did the fitment this morning and touch wood, no fault codes or issues so far. I will be replacing the dessicant and O rings in the compressor tomorrow, as a maintenance item. The job was a little fiddly, however was done in an hour or so.

    I also purchased an O ring set for the Valve block, so will strip, clean and reassemble in the next few weeks as a spare.
